Design Notes Every Seasonal Embroiderer Should Keep Handy
- Digitize with stitch density in mind—dense fills work for home decor, lighter fills for apparel.
- Create realistic mockups using the 3600 x 3600 pixel files—these scale beautifully for social media previews and Etsy banners.
- Plan matching color palettes around natural metallics: antique brass, rose gold, charcoal gray, and oatmeal—not just classic gold.
- Use proper stabilizer for each fabric texture: tear-away for stable wovens, cutaway for knits, and heavy-duty for towels.
- Confirm commercial licensing terms directly with the seller—since these are digital papers (not pre-digitized embroidery files), usage rights for finished products must be verified.
